Laundry Room Makeover: Incredible Before & After Inspiration

A laundry room is often the most overlooked space in a home, relegated to a dark corner or a cluttered garage. However, a laundry room transformation can do more than just make chores easier; it can actually increase your home’s value. If you’re tired of sorting clothes in a cramped, uninspiring space, these laundry room makeover ideas will help you envision a fresh, functional sanctuary.

1. The Power of a Laundry Room Transformation

Before diving into the “after,” it is important to assess the “before.” Most standard laundry rooms suffer from poor lighting and wasted vertical space. A successful makeover starts with identifying your biggest pain point—whether it’s a lack of folding surface or nowhere to hang air-dry items.

2. Planning Your Before and After Layout

The secret to a dramatic before and after is the flow. In the planning phase, consider the “work triangle”: the distance between your washer, the sorting area, and the drying rack. Shifting just one cabinet can open up the entire room.

3. Choosing a Cohesive Color Palette

To make a small room feel expansive, stick to light, reflective colors. Soft whites, sage greens, or dusty blues are popular in modern laundry room makeovers. Using a consistent color on the walls and cabinetry creates a seamless, professional look.

4. Maximizing Vertical Storage with Open Shelving

If your “before” photo shows floor clutter, the “after” needs shelving. Open wooden shelves above the washer and dryer provide easy access to detergents while allowing you to display decorative jars or plants to “groom” the space.

5. Upgrading to High-Functioning Countertops

One of the biggest upgrades in a laundry room transformation is adding a folding station. By installing a countertop directly over front-loading machines, you create a massive workspace that prevents clothes from ending up on the floor.

6. Smart Lighting for Dark Workspaces

Laundry rooms are often windowless. Replacing a single bulb with recessed lighting or an elegant flush-mount fixture can change the entire mood. Under-cabinet LED strips are also a great way to illuminate your workspace.

7. Innovative Drying Solutions

Not everything can go in the dryer. A sleek, wall-mounted accordion rack or a pull-down drying bar is a must-have for a modern makeover. These tuck away when not in use, keeping your “after” look clean and tidy.

8. Flooring That Stands Up to Moisture

Since this is a high-moisture area, your laundry room makeover should include durable flooring. Luxury Vinyl Plank (LVP) or patterned ceramic tiles are excellent choices that provide a high-end look without the fear of water damage.

9. Organizing with Baskets and Bins

Visual clutter is the enemy of a beautiful blog-worthy laundry room. Use matching wicker baskets or wire bins to hide away “ugly” essentials like lint rollers, stain removers, and extra sponges.

10. Adding Personality with Hardware and Decor

The “after” is in the details. Swapping out standard plastic handles for matte black or brushed gold hardware can make basic cabinets look custom. Don’t forget a small rug or a piece of wall art to make the room feel like a part of your home.

11. Maintenance Tips for Your New Space

Once your laundry room transformation is complete, keep it Pinterest-ready by doing a 5-minute “reset” every evening. Clear the countertops, wipe down the machine lids, and ensure your baskets are organized for the next day’s load.
